Interior Minister holds meeting with Governors

Interior Minister, General Shaikh Rashid bin Abdullah Al Khalifa, held a meeting today with the Governors. He hailed their role in reinforcing interaction with citizens and residents, through the governorates’ events and programmes and following precautionary measures.

He highlighted that the fishermen case is supported by His Majesty King Hamad bin Isa Al Khalifa and His Royal Highness Prince Salman bin Hamad Al Khalifa, the Crown Prince and Prime Minister. He said based on the support and the royal directives to protect fishermen and their livelihoods, the Capital Governor provided the assistance ordered by HM the King to fishermen to ensure decent living for all citizens.

During the meeting, His Highness the Southern Governor briefed the attendees about the CCTVs in the governorate and their role in reinforcing security and public safety. He also highlighted the campaigns in the district to promote social distancing as part of community partnership, pointing out the security needs of Khalifa City.

The Muharraq Governor discussed issues related to the governorate, including allocating an area for food trucks and financial assistance. The Interior Minister ordered fast processing of assistance for humanitarian and accident cases and to take immediate procedures in emergencies and urgent cases.

The Capital Governor reviewed the efforts of the governorates in studying the requirements of the residents during the COVID-19 pandemic and the allocation of areas to build shelters, along with the formation of a team of volunteers. He discussed inspection campaigns of gas cylinders shops in coordination with the General Directorate of Civil Defence. The Interior Minister highlighted the importance to utilise modern technology to prevent accidents.

The Northern Governor highlighted the efforts of the governorate in promoting general safety.

At the end of the meeting, the Interior Minister highlighted the importance for the governor to continue interacting with citizens through modern technology and promote ties with organisations to meet people’s aspiration.
